Understanding Etched Surfaces
Etching is a process that creates permanent marks, grooves, or indentations on a surface. When a surface is etched through chemical, mechanical, or laser methods, it creates a physical alteration that becomes part of the material structure. These marks are designed to be durable and resistant to everyday wear and tear.

What is surface etching used for?
Surface etching creates durable marks on materials for decoration, precision measurement, and functional guidance. It's commonly employed in jewelry, glassware, metalwork, and precision instruments to create lasting designs and reference lines.
How long does surface etching last?
Surface etching is permanent because it physically alters the material structure. Unlike surface markings that wear away, etched patterns remain indefinitely unless the surface is resurfaced or heavily abraded.
Can you remove surface etching?
Removing surface etching requires sanding, grinding, or polishing the surface down past the etched depth. The ease of removal depends on the material and the depth of the etching.
